The Moth is an acclaimed not-for-profit organization dedicated to the art and craft of storytelling, with public events that are broadcasted each Saturday at 10pm on KQED Public Radio (88.5.)

We've got five pairs of tickets to give away to their Tuesday, March 6 show (theme: "Tests") at at Freight & Salvage in Berkeley.
